What Do The Rich Man and The Prostitute Have In Common? (Luke 16, Revelation 17-18)
The rich man, in The Story of the Rich Man and Lazarus, and the prostitute of Revelation have the following in common:
The were clothed in purple and fine linen.
They lived in luxury.
They burned in fire.
Who is the rich man and the prostitute?
The Rich Man = The Religious Leaders In Jerusalem
The religious elite in Jerusalem wore purple and fine linen and lived in luxury just as the rich man in the parable.
In Exodus 28:1-6, the clothing of the priests included purple and fine linen.
In Exodus 25-40, purple and fine linen are used in the construction of the old covenant sanctuary.
The Prostitute = The Great City Of Jerusalem
Purple and fine linen are also used in the construction of the Temple in Jerusalem (2 Chronicles 3:14).
In Revelation 17-18, Jerusalem is clothed in purple and fine linen and lived in luxury.
In AD 70, Jerusalem burned to the ground along with the religious leaders in Jerusalem.
